Arsenal
Gaël Clichy believes that William Gallas’s captaincy has brought a positive influence, despite the France defender’s frequent absence because of injury. “William has a young spirit and knows how to talk to the players,” the left back said.
Played 8 Won 7 Drawn 1 Lost 0 For 19 Against 6 Points 22
Next match Saturday Oct 20 Bolton Wanderers (h)
Manchester United
Sporting Lisbon have denied that they have given United first refusal if they decide to sell Miguel Veloso, 21, their utility player. United have a strong relationship with Sporting, from whom they signed Cristiano Ronaldo and Nani.
Played 9 Won 6 Drawn 2 Lost 1 For 11 Against 2 Points 20
Next match Saturday Oct 20 Aston Villa (a)

Portsmouth
Linvoy Primus saw a specialist yesterday for a second opinion on his left knee. The 34-year-old had an operation in the summer but is still feeling discomfort. His return to the first-team squad is expected to be delayed by a further fortnight.
Played 9 Won 4 Drawn 3 Lost 2 For 17 Against 12 Points 15
Next match Saturday Oct 20 Wigan Athletic (a)

Birmingham City
Steve Bruce wants to discuss his future with the club’s prospective owner, Carson Yeung, before the next match. The manager fears Yeung’s refusal to agree his new contract is not only ominous for him but could also harm the team.
Played 9 Won 2 Drawn 2 Lost 5 For 8 Against 12 Points 8
Next match Saturday Oct 20 Manchester City (a)
